Mount Vernon, Dayton, OH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Mount Vernon?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Mount Vernon Studio Apartments | $1,101 | $700 | $1,537 |
| Mount Vernon 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,258 | $650 | $2,037 |
| Mount Vernon 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,610 | $750 | $3,102 |
| Mount Vernon 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,718 | $945 | $3,512 |
